Streak is the developer of an eponymous customer relationship management platform for Gmail. Streak was founded by Aleem Mawani and Omar Ismail and is a graduate of the Y Combinator seed accelerator. The company has received $1.9 million in venture capital from investors including Battery Ventures, Crunchfund, Floodgate, Michael Birch, Chris Sacca, and David Tish. Streak is also the developer of SecureGmail, open-source Google Chrome extension that allows users to encrypt Gmail messages.

History

Streak was founded in 2011 by Aleem Mawani, a former Google product manager, and Omar Ismail to solve their sales needs. It was accepted into Y Combinator's Summer 2011 class and graduated from the accelerator in early 2012. The company held a soft launch of its platform in January 2012. Streak entered open beta in March of that year.

Product

Streak is a spreadsheet-style customer relationship management plug-in for Gmail that supports both Google Chrome and Safari web browsers. Users connect the plugin to their Google account via OpenID and do not share their login credentials with Streak. Streak was released as an iOS application in August 2013. Streak added email read receipts to its platform in early 2014.
